What Features Make an Office Chair Well-Constructed?

The features that make an office chair well-constructed are crucial for ensuring comfort, durability, and ergonomic support.

  • Ergonomic Design: A well-constructed office chair should have an ergonomic design that promotes good posture and supports the natural curve of the spine. This includes adjustable lumbar support, which helps to reduce strain on the lower back during long hours of sitting.
  • Quality Materials: The materials used in the chair, including the frame, upholstery, and padding, should be high-quality and durable. Chairs made from breathable fabrics and sturdy, lightweight frames tend to last longer and provide better comfort than those made from cheaper materials.
  • Adjustability: A key feature of a well-constructed office chair is its adjustability. This includes height adjustment, seat depth adjustment, and adjustable armrests, which allow users to tailor the chair to their specific body dimensions and preferences, enhancing overall comfort.
  • Stability and Mobility: A well-constructed chair should have a stable base, typically with five casters for balance and ease of movement. A sturdy base prevents tipping, while smooth-rolling casters enable easy mobility across various floor surfaces.
  • Weight Capacity: The chair should have a weight capacity that accommodates a wide range of users. A well-constructed office chair is designed to support different body types without compromising stability or safety.
  • Warranty and Brand Reputation: A good warranty indicates the manufacturer’s confidence in their product’s durability. Chairs from reputable brands that offer solid warranties are often better constructed, as they are more likely to stand the test of time.

What Materials Are Essential for Durability and Comfort in Office Chairs?

The materials essential for durability and comfort in office chairs include:

  • High-Quality Upholstery: The choice of fabric or leather plays a crucial role in the comfort and longevity of an office chair. Breathable materials like mesh allow for airflow, keeping the user cool, while leather offers a more luxurious feel and is generally more durable.
  • Supportive Foam Padding: The type and density of foam used in the seat and backrest greatly influence comfort levels. High-density foam provides better support and maintains its shape over time, reducing the risk of wear and tear.
  • Durable Frame Materials: The chair’s frame can be made from various materials, including metal, plastic, or wood. Metal frames, particularly steel, offer superior strength and stability, while plastic can be lightweight but may lack long-term durability.
  • Adjustable Components: Features such as height-adjustable seats and lumbar support are often constructed using high-quality mechanisms that enhance usability and comfort. These adjustments cater to different body types, ensuring that users can find their optimal sitting position.
  • Quality Casters and Base: The wheels and base of the chair are vital for mobility and stability. Heavy-duty casters made from durable materials allow for smooth movement across various surfaces, while a sturdy base helps prevent tipping and ensures safety.

How Do Ergonomic Designs Contribute to the Overall Quality of an Office Chair?

  • Adjustable Features: Ergonomic office chairs often come with multiple adjustable components, such as seat height, backrest angle, and armrest position. These features allow users to customize the chair to their specific body dimensions, promoting better posture and reducing the risk of strain or injury.
  • Lumbar Support: Many well-constructed office chairs include built-in lumbar support, which helps maintain the natural curve of the spine. This support is essential for preventing lower back pain, especially for individuals who sit for extended periods.
  • Breathable Materials: The use of breathable fabrics and padding in ergonomic chairs enhances comfort by allowing better air circulation. This feature helps to regulate temperature and moisture, reducing discomfort during long hours of sitting.
  • Stable Base and Mobility: A well-designed ergonomic chair typically features a sturdy base with smooth-rolling casters. This stability and mobility enable users to move around their workspace easily without straining, contributing to overall productivity and comfort.
  • Seat Depth and Width: Ergonomic chairs consider variations in body sizes by offering different seat depths and widths. This adaptability ensures that users can sit comfortably without feeling cramped or unsupported, which is crucial for maintaining focus and efficiency.
  • Recline Functionality: The ability to recline in an ergonomic chair allows users to shift their weight and relieve pressure on their spine and hips. This feature encourages movement throughout the day, which is important for reducing fatigue and increasing comfort during prolonged sitting sessions.

Which Brands Are Renowned for Producing the Best Constructed Office Chairs?

Several brands are well-regarded for producing the best constructed office chairs:

  • Herman Miller: Known for their iconic designs like the Aeron chair, Herman Miller chairs are celebrated for their ergonomic features and high-quality materials.
  • Steelcase: Steelcase chairs are designed to support a range of postures and movements, featuring adjustable settings that cater to individual comfort and productivity.
  • Humanscale: Humanscale focuses on minimalist design and functionality, creating chairs that promote healthy sitting habits and are made with sustainable materials.
  • Secretlab: Originally known for gaming chairs, Secretlab has expanded its offerings to include office chairs that combine aesthetics with comfort and durability.
  • Haworth: Haworth chairs are designed with flexibility in mind, allowing users to customize their seating experience while ensuring long-lasting performance.

Herman Miller chairs incorporate advanced ergonomic research, making them suitable for extended use while retaining stylish designs that fit modern office aesthetics. The brand also emphasizes sustainability, often using recycled materials in their products.

Steelcase chairs are engineered to address the varying needs of users throughout the workday, featuring mechanisms that allow for easy adjustments to fit different body types and preferences. Their focus on research-driven design helps improve workplace productivity and comfort.

Humanscale’s approach to office seating emphasizes simplicity and efficiency, with designs that encourage natural movement and alignment. The company’s commitment to sustainability is reflected in their use of eco-friendly materials and manufacturing processes.

Secretlab has gained a reputation for their comfortable and stylish gaming chairs, and they have successfully transitioned to office seating by maintaining the same level of quality and support. Their chairs often feature customizable components and premium materials that enhance user experience.

Haworth’s office chairs are built to adapt to various work environments, offering features that promote collaboration and individual work. Their designs support a wide range of postures, ensuring that users can remain comfortable and engaged throughout the day.

What Are the Long-Term Benefits of Choosing a Well-Constructed Office Chair?

The long-term benefits of choosing a well-constructed office chair include improved health, enhanced productivity, and increased comfort.

  • Improved Posture: A well-constructed office chair is designed to support the natural curve of the spine, promoting better posture. This helps to reduce strain on the back and neck, preventing discomfort and long-term musculoskeletal issues.
  • Enhanced Comfort: Quality office chairs often feature adjustable components, such as seat height, armrests, and lumbar support. This customization allows users to find their ideal seating position, leading to greater comfort during long hours of work.
  • Increased Productivity: When employees are comfortable and properly supported, they are more likely to focus on their tasks and work efficiently. A well-constructed chair minimizes distractions caused by discomfort, contributing to higher overall productivity levels.
  • Durability and Longevity: Investing in a high-quality office chair typically means it is built to last, using durable materials that withstand daily use. This not only saves money in the long run by reducing the need for frequent replacements but also ensures consistent support over time.
  • Reduced Health Risks: Prolonged sitting in poorly designed chairs can lead to various health issues, including obesity, cardiovascular disease, and chronic pain. A well-constructed office chair mitigates these risks by promoting movement and encouraging better circulation throughout the body.
  • Better Aesthetics: High-quality office chairs often feature a more refined design and finish, contributing to a professional-looking workspace. This can enhance the overall atmosphere of an office, making it more inviting for both employees and clients.

How Can You Identify Quality and Construction in Office Chairs When Shopping?

When shopping for the best constructed office chair, consider the following key factors:

  • Material Quality: The materials used in an office chair significantly affect its durability and comfort. Look for chairs made from high-grade materials such as premium leathers or breathable mesh that can withstand daily use while providing adequate support.
  • Frame Construction: A sturdy frame is essential for stability and longevity. Chairs made from solid wood or high-quality steel frames are generally more durable and can support heavier weights without compromising safety or integrity.
  • Adjustability Features: Find a chair that offers multiple adjustability options, including seat height, armrests, and lumbar support. These features allow for personalized comfort and promote better posture, which is crucial for long hours of sitting.
  • Cushioning and Padding: The quality of cushioning affects comfort during extended use. Look for chairs with high-density foam or gel cushions that provide adequate support and help reduce pressure points while ensuring that the padding retains its shape over time.
  • Warranty and Brand Reputation: A strong warranty indicates the manufacturer’s confidence in their product’s quality. Additionally, consider brands known for their commitment to quality and customer service, as this can be a good indicator of the chair’s construction standards.
